Distributed Polarization-Mode-Dispersion Measurement in Fiber Links by Polarization-Sensitive Reflectometric Techniques

GALTAROSSA, ANDREA;PALMIERI, LUCA;SCHENATO, LUCA
2008

Abstract

We present a theoretical analysis showing how to measure the instantaneous differential group delay of an arbitrary subsection of a link, by means of a polarization-sensitive reflectometric measurement as, for instance, polarization optical time-domain reflectometry. Analytical predictions are supported and validated by preliminary experimental results
